Establishment and partial characterisation of a human fibrosarcoma cell line MR-83
Abstract:
We describe a mycoplasma-free human fibrosarcoma cell line, MR-83, which grows readily in liquid culture and as clones in semi-solid agar with a plating efficiency of about 0.5%. It has a stable karyotype consisting of a modal number of 49-51 chromosomes, with two translocations and a deletion. The cell line shows resistance to adriamycin in semi-solid agar assay, and responds to Epidermal Growth Factor (EGF) by increased DNA synthesis, as measured by thymidine uptake.
